Following the Norman Conquest at the Battle of Hastings, Norman culture transformed the country, as William I governed through force and bureaucracy. One of his lasting legacies - the Domesday Book - was the result of a complex and extensive survey to find out who owned what, and how much tax they should pay. It provided a snapshot of medieval life and has survived almost 1,000 years of turmoil, war and politics. The Domesday Book can still be consulted in modern legal disputes today, but how did William’s bureaucrats create such an in-depth document about an entire kingdom? What does the book reveal about the king’s ruthless methods of conquering? And what light does it shine on the so-called Dark Ages? This is a Short History Of The Domesday Book.
